While reporters spend all their time telling us about Egypt, politicians in the United States are taking advantage of the fact that nobody is paying attention to other issues; the politicians are up to their old tricks in the Congress and state senates.
For example, anti-choice Republicans have presented a bill in Congress that attempts to redefine sexual abuse in order to lessen the number of rape victims that could get an abortion through Medicaid, which is already on a tight budget.
If the bill passes, a woman would have to get government approval that her rape was indeed "forced" (as if a rape could be defined any other way) in order to meet the necessary requirements.
Medicaid is a healthcare program that serves low-income people. This cruel and scandalous bill is nothing more than another act of aggression against poor women.
Luckily, although in the minority, there are Democratic legislators and perhaps even female Republican congress members who could not, with a clean conscience, vote for such a horrible measure.
While politicians in Iowa are trying to repeal the state law that allows gay marriage that was passed in 2009, the new governor of New Mexico, Susana Martinez, a Republican Latina, has given the green light to police and state patrollers to ask about the immigration status of anyone they arrest.
